Hello Cairo!

It’s never easy to keep up with the breakneck speed of life in Cairo, but with the weekend at our doorsteps, it’s time to switch off, tune out and generally just lose your inhibitions.

It’s been a busy week at Mizan, and Thursday sees the Maadi venue welcome the ‘Esmo Eh…?’ Theatre Company for Mime Night. Elsewhere, Cairo Jazz Club get the weekend started with a double-header of live music as Deja’vu and Bluenotes perform, while Dokki nightspot, Alchemy, weave some magic with vodka at Shiver.

The Salah El Din Citadel kicks off two days of music with Fete de la Musique, offering an impressive line-up of local bands including Salalem and the Egyptian Project. Meanwhile, 14-year-old Nathalie Saba takes to the stage of Zamalek’s Jazz Mate, while Egyptian Hip Hop Union brings together top local hip-hop talent at El Sawy Culturewheel.

Cairo’s bars and clubs are coming out swinging as always, with Top of the Pops at Tamarai, DJ Simon providing the music at Roof Bar, another edition of Music Loves You Back at Y Lounge and Car Cafe Club hosting its weekly Commercial Night.  

Doing things a little differently this weekend, Almaz are holding a rather peculiar Incognito Costume Party; nothing says naughty like a dressing up, wouldn’t you say?

We begin Friday bright and early at the Sofitel Cairo El Gezirah, where the Zamalek hotel is throwing a La Fete de la Musique of its own, with an eclectic range of live musical acts taking centrestage at several of the hotel’s venues. Elsewhere, Roof Bar’s Summer Splash is offering Cairnenes a bit of sunbathing, drinking and DJ Zizo on the decks.

Somehow making the link between fashion and Ramadan, Arkan Mall welcomes Cairo’s fashionistas and shopaholics to Feminine Touch’s Ahlan Ramadan bazaar. Elsewhere, film lovers will enjoy Balcon Lounge’s Darren Aronofsky Movie Marathon, while Cairo’s musicians are invited to Vibe Studios in Dokki for Open Jam 3.

Later in the day, Baha El Ansari perfroms at 100Copies Music Space and  Hungarian songstress, Sofia Balogh tales to the mic at Jazz Mate one last time.

Things pick up even later in the day at Cairo Jazz Club, where DJs Hassan Abou Alem, Fahmy and Samba will take to the decks, while O Bar hosts another R&B Night and Amici Heliopolis celebrates Cairo’s blessed weather with Summer Atmosphere.

Fitness is the order of the day on Saturday, as Zamalek’s Aquarium Grotto Garden hosts the Heartbeat Zumbathon; a day that will also include live music and entertainment – plus, 75% of the proceeds go straight to the Magdi Yacoub Heart Foundation. Alternatively, Belly Lorna will help you get a sweat on with Bellydancing for Beginners at Euro Club Heliopolis.

Live music comes courtesy of Sarah El Gohary and Ashara Gharby at Cairo Jazz Club, as well and the always interesting No Comment, who are back at After Eight, while Amici Zamalek pulls out the fondue pots for another Wine & Fondue Night.

On the art-front, several exhibitions are kicking off this weekend, including ‘We are the End of the World’ by Mohamed El Masry at Artellewa and Summer Collection at Picasso Gallery.

These are just a few of the events awaiting you this weekend; check out the Cairo 360 events for more.
